3.3 V Dual-Loop, 50 Mbps to 3.3 Gbps
Laser Diode Driver
ADN2870

The ADN2870 laser diode driver is designed for advanced SFP
and SFF modules, using SFF-8472 digital diagnostics. The device
features dual-loop control of the average power and extinction
ratio, which automatically compensates for variations in laser
characteristics over temperature and aging. The laser need only
be calibrated at 25°C, eliminating the need for expensive and
time consuming temperature calibration. The ADN2870 supports
single-rate operation from 50 Mbps to 3.3 Gbps or multirate
from 155 Mbps to 3.3 Gbps.
Average power and extinction ratio can be set with a voltage
provided by a microcontroller DAC or by a trimmable resistor.
The part provides bias and modulation current monitoring as
well as fail alarms and automatic laser shutdown. The device
interfaces easily with the ADI ADuC70xx family of micro-
converters and with the ADN289x family of limiting amplifiers
to make a complete SFP/SFF transceiver solution. An SFP
reference design is available. The product is available in a space-
saving 4 mm ×4 mm LFCSP package specified over the −40°C to
+85°C temperature range.

APPLICATIONS
Multirate OC3 to OC48-FEC SFP/SFF modules
1×/2×/4× Fibre channel SFP/SFF modules
LX-4 modules
DWDM/CWDM SFP modules
1GE SFP/SFF transceiver modules
